“Claimant” means an applicant for or recipient of services who has filed for a fair hearing.
Each regional center and each vendor that contracts with a regional center to provide services to recipients shall conspicuously post on its internet web, if any, links to the department’s internet website page that provides a description of the appeals process set forth in this chapter and department contact information for providing information and education to recipients and applicants about the appeals process, including the notice of proposed action, timelines, options for resolving disagreements, and rights during the appeals process.
